Ortofon 2M Black - My last MM. (pic)
Posted by HenryH on February 23, 2008 at 12:57:51:
Well, yes, the subject line says it all. This is one fine cartridge MM or MC or whatever. The Shibata stylus gives me the best, most open, transparent and extended top end of any cartridge I've ever owned. Comparing it to my reference Dyna 20XL, I give the Dyna a subtle edge in the bass and midrange, but the Black pulls away on top. It is detailed without the sterility and lack of "soul" I heard from my OC9. The top end simply shimmers. Brushed cymbals have that harmonic sheen that few carts can accurately capture and most simply smear.
And the Ortofon is nimble, like the Dyna. It wants to boogie when the music calls for it and is laid back when that is called for. It's a good tracker, too. No signs of mistracking at 1.6 g VTF.
Associated equipment includes the Scout/JMW-9, Hagerman Cornet II (no SUT required, a plus), Hagerman Clarinet line stage, NAD C272 power amp (the Forte is in CA for upgrades and a conversion to Class A operation) and Maggie MMGs supplemented by an Infinity sub.
Let's put it this way. I like the Black enough to plunk down $400 for a third wand for my JMW-9. I now can quickly swap from among three good carts.
The 2M Black has a MSRP of $599, but Thakker on eBay sells it for $100 less. Highly recommended.
